Brain Stem
The posterior part of the brain, adjoined to the spinal cord, that controls basic life functions such as heartbeat, breathing, and blood pressure.
Cerebellum
A part of the brain located at the back of the skull that is responsible for coordinating voluntary movements and maintaining balance and posture.
Frontal Lobe
The part of the brain located at the front of each cerebral hemisphere, responsible for voluntary movement, expressive language, and managing higher-level executive functions.
Hippocampus
The Hippocampus is a major component of the brain, important in the consolidation of information from short-term to long-term memory and in spatial memory that enables navigation.
